Post-Installation Procedures
Which files you need to check in manually
Files that you must check into the master repository or the Repository after you
install the software are listed below. For more information, see Supported Products
and Features in the ePolicy Orchestrator 3.0 Product Guide or Help.
n Contents of the McAfee AutoUpdate Architect 1.0 master repository — Packages
that were checked into the McAfee AutoUpdate Architect master repository
are not migrated to the ePolicy Orchestrator 3.0 master repository.
n Custom packages — Only custom packages created with McAfee Installation
Designer 7.0 can be checked into the master repository.
n Policy pages — To manage products whose policy page is not added to the
Repository during the installation, you must manually add their policy page to
the
Repository.
n Product plug-in files — Any product plug-in (.DLL) files that were not checked
in as part of the installation, must be checked into the master repository
manually.
n Products — If you are installing the software for the first time, you must check
in all products that you want to deploy via ePolicy Orchestrator. If you are
upgrading the software, any supported products that were not already in the
Repository must be checked into the master repository manually.
NOTE
VirusScan ThinClient 6.0 and 6.1 are exceptions. You need to
check these products into the master repository regardless of
whether they were already in the
Repository.
n Product updates — You must check in all product updates that you want to
deploy via ePolicy Orchestrator. One exception is product plug-in (.
DLL) files
that were converted as part of the installation.
Deploying product plug-in files
You must schedule an ePolicy Orchestrator agent | Update client task in order to
deploy new and updated product plug-in (.
DLL) files to client computers. These
plug-in files are required for agent-to-server communication. For instructions, see
Scheduling client tasks in the ePolicy Orchestrator 3.0 Product Guide or Help.
